COLUMBIA, Mo. – Mizzou Volleyball clinched its second consecutive trip to the Sweet 16 last weekend, following victories over No. 19 Kansas and No. 16 Wichita State. Up next, the Tigers will head to No. 1 national seed Penn State on Friday (Dec. 8) for the 2017 NCAA University Park Regional.
General admission all-session tickets this weekend are available for $16 each. Tiger fans interested in attending the matches are encouraged to visit GoPSUSports.com for complete ticket information.
First serve inside Rec Hall between the Tigers and Nittany Lions is scheduled for 1 p.m. CT. The match will broadcast live on ESPNU with Sam Gore and Dain Blanton on the call.
The University Park Regional Final (Elite Eight) is scheduled for 7 p.m. CT this Saturday (Dec. 9) on ESPNU. The winner between Mizzou and Penn State will meet the victor from Michigan State and Illinois' Sweet 16 matchup.
